    Job Description Process Safety Manager The Process Safety Manager will be responsible for leading the strategic development, implementation, and continuous improvement of OSHA PSM (process safety management) systems at the Red Diamond Austin Powder Manufacturing plant. This leadership role ensures full compliance with OSHA Process Safety Management (PSM) standards while proactively managing operational risks. This role will also encompass the EPA RMP compliance program, maintaining documentation per regulations. The manager will serve as a key driver of a safety-first culture, promoting reliability and professional growth across a diverse workforce that includes entry-level operators, engineers, and plant leadership. Additionally, this role will provide mentorship and technical guidance to engineering and operations teams to support safe and efficient plant performance. Key Responsibilities and Duties: • Collaborate with plant leadership to align safety initiatives with operational goals. • Own and maintain the plant's PSM program in accordance with OSHA 29 CFR 1910.119.for safe operation and compliance of the facility. • Own EPA RMP program and maintain compliance • Work with company and consultants to deliver on PSM and RMP materials required • Conduct and lead Process Hazard Analyses (PHAs), including HAZOP and What-If studies. • Ensure timely completion of Management of Change (MOC) processes. • Oversee mechanical integrity programs for critical equipment. • Lead incident investigations and root cause analyses for process-related events. • Maintain and update operating procedures and ensure employee training compliance. • Interface with regulatory agencies and ensure audit readiness. • Other duties as assigned.     Student employment at the University of Rio Grande / Rio Grande Community College is designed to augment student educational goals with work experience. It aims to increase student skills while strengthening student connections to the campus and the community. Rio offers a variety of student employment opportunities with varying job responsibilities. Departments who typically employ students include: Academic Centers Academic Support (Tutors) Admissions Art Department Athletics Bookstore Campus Computing & Networking (IT) Financial Aid Fitness Center Food Service / Cafeteria Institutional Advancement Library Madog Center for Welsh Studies Maintenance & Grounds Marketing Post Office Registrar/Records Rio Grande Elementary School (America Reads Program) School of Allied Health & Exercise Studies School of Business School of Education School of Liberal Arts & Social Sciences School of Natural Sciences School of Nursing School of Technologies Student Engagement Student Success Center Qualifications: Must be at least 18 years old Must be an active student or accepted for enrollment in an undergraduate or graduate program leading to a degree or certificate (College Credit Plus (CCP) students are not eligible for student employment). Must be carrying at least six (6) credit hours in the current term Must have a minimum of a 2.0 grade point average (GPA) and be in good academic standing without any type of halt or hold on their record. Must be eligible to work in the United States in accordance with federal I-9 immigration requirements and provide appropriate documentation to Human Resources. Students must be cleared by Human Resources BEFORE beginning any type of employment. Work Limitations Students are limited to working up to sixteen (16) hours per week and/or the amount of federal work study funds awarded by financial aid. Students may work in the summer only if funds remain. Students are prohibited from working during scheduled class times. Student applications are only good for the 2025-26 academic year. Students must reapply annually. Pay All student employees are paid an hourly wage rate equivalent to the minimum wage rate in effect at the time (currently $10.45/hour). Student employees are paid on a semi-monthly basis on the 15th and 30th of each month. In cases of weekends and holidays, the pay dates may be adjusted. Direct deposit is required. Application Procedures: Interested students must complete an application through Rio's online application tracking system (Paycor) found on the institution's employment opportunities website. All hiring departments use this applicant pool to fill student vacancies.
